The Bosco della Pastrona, a green area of approximately 50 hectares, connects the river with the city of Casale Monferrato. Partly managed by the Po Park, it includes a picnic area and a mountain biking and running trail called "Kintana". This 10 km route was inaugurated in May 2014 after a redevelopment period supported by the Piedmont Region and private volunteers. Thanks to an agreement with the Municipality of Casale Monferrato, the area is managed by private individuals for maintenance and the organization of events. Currently managed by the non-profit association "Fiab Monferrato Bike", the route is challenging but accessible to all. The terrain is suitable for all seasons, except for adverse weather conditions. During the excursion, you can enjoy the flora and fauna along the Po and choose where to stop at the technical points. The route has three rings with different levels of difficulty and connections to other paths, starting from the Monferrato Castle and ending at the pier. The management of the area involves the local community and offers an opportunity to reconnect with the Po river.

Fast and fun route. Pay attention after the first jump, there is the variant on the left full of Whoops and some parabolic and jumps. You can enter stronger and cleaner by taking the ramp all to the right which allows you to bank and cut to the left directly at the entrance on the variant.

Bosco della Pastrona, Casale Monferrato. Wood with two main itineraries, Blue Cycle and Pedestrian path in both directions, for a length of about 3.5 km. Red route instead longer, about 7.5 km. The Kintana trails are great for learning MTB technique.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of cycling trails can I find around San Giorgio Monferrato?

The Monferrato region, including areas around San Giorgio Monferrato, offers a diverse network of trails suitable for mountain biking (MTB), trekking, gravel cycling, and e-biking. You'll find routes winding through picturesque vineyards, dense woods, and rolling hills, catering to various skill levels.

Are there specific bike parks or dedicated MTB trails near San Giorgio Monferrato?

While San Giorgio Monferrato itself is integrated into a broader trail network, you can find dedicated MTB experiences. For instance, the Kintana Trail in Bosco della Pastrona offers two main itineraries ideal for learning MTB technique. Another option is the Wooden Bridge and MTB Trail in Area Attrezzata Sponde Fluviali di Casale Monferrato, which takes you through a cleared forest path.

What are some challenging trails for experienced mountain bikers in the area?

For experienced riders seeking a challenge, DH4 The Benches is known for being a fast and fun route with whoops, parabolic turns, and jumps. Another technical option is the Downhill Trail DH 2, which features a very technical and steep first section, best avoided after rain.

Are there family-friendly cycling options or easier trails around San Giorgio Monferrato?

Yes, the Monferrato region provides routes for all skill levels. The Kintana Trail, located in Bosco della Pastrona, is excellent for those looking to learn mountain biking technique, with both blue (3.5 km) and red (7.5 km) routes. The broader region also has many moderate trails suitable for family outings.

What natural features can I expect to see while cycling in Monferrato?

Cycling in Monferrato offers stunning natural beauty. You'll traverse through colorful vineyards, dense forests, and rolling hills. The Po River at Bosco della Pastrona highlight, for example, allows you to enjoy the flora and fauna along the Po river, with picnic areas available.

What is the best time of year to go cycling around San Giorgio Monferrato?

The trails in the Monferrato region are generally rideable year-round, except during adverse weather conditions.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ant landscapes, making them ideal for exploring the vineyards and forests. Some technical trails, like Downhill Trail DH 2, are best avoided if it has rained.

Are there any bike parks in the wider Piemonte region with uplift services?

Yes, while San Giorgio Monferrato focuses on natural trails, the wider Piemonte region hosts several bike parks with uplift services. For example, Kona Bike Park Bardonecchia offers 400 km of trails with two chairlifts and a cable car, and Monte Alpet Bike Park allows riders to take their bikes on a chairlift for downhill and freeride trails.
